How do you determine the atomic mass of chlorine?

Well, the CI atomic number is 17. The atomic mass is 35.4527 amu.
There are two stable isotopes of chlorine with relative mass numbers 35 and 37. As the relative abundance of these isotopes are 75% and 25% respectively, the molar mass of chlorine is considered as 35.5 g/mol.

Is Kinetic Energy dependent on Atomic Mass?

For a singe molecule, Yes:

KE = (1/2)mv^2

Where m is mass, and v is velocity or speed of the center of the mass.

-or-

by relating to momentum:

KE=(p^2)/2m

Where p is momentum and m is again mass.

However, the AVERAGE kinetic energy of one mole of molecules does NOT depend on mass:

KE = (3/2)RT

where R is the molar gas constant, and T in temperature in Kelvin.

The average molecular kinetic energy for an ideal gas, depends solely on temperature.

How do you write a mathematical formula for figuring out the number of neutrons in an atom if you know the atomic number and the atomic mass?

It's quite simple. It's just the atomic mass minus the atomic number. That's because the atomic number is simply the number of protons and the atomic mass is (almost exactly) the number of protons plus neutrons. Unfortunately there is a complication.

The problem is that a particular element can have more than one isotope.

Each isotope has the same number of protons, but different numbers of neutrons. This can make the atomic mass a messy number that's not a nice whole number.
